Nancy Xu
Founder and CEO of Moonhub
Nancy Xu, founder and CEO of Moonhub, an AI-powered recruiting platform used by billion-dollar companies to hire top talent.
Born in China and raised in the US, Xu became the first person to complete a dual PhD in AI and MBA at Stanford University. She trained for the US Math and Physics teams as a student and later co-founded The Gradient, a widely read AI publication focused on research and industry developments.
She began her career at Meta's AI research division before leading healthcare AI and automation at AKASA.
In 2022, she founded Moonhub, aiming to improve hiring with AI. Unlike traditional recruiting tools that rely on keyword searches, Moonhub’s AI scans billions of data points from platforms like LinkedIn, GitHub, and Google Scholar to identify qualified candidates.
The startup has seen remarkable success:
• Secured over $14M in funding from investors like Khosla Ventures, GV (Google Ventures), and Marc Benioff.
• Surpassed $1M in revenue in its first year.
• Used by 100+ companies, including AI unicorns like Inflection and Anthropic.
Beyond Moonhub, Xu is an active investor through Xu Ventures, backing early-stage AI startups shaping the future of work. Her contributions to AI and the recruiting industry have earned her a spot on TIME's 100 Most Influential People in AI (2023).
